#528ab2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#528ab2 is composed of 32.2% red, 54.1%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.9% cyan, 22.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 205 degrees, a saturation of 38.4% and a lightness of 51%. #528ab2 color hex could be obtained by blending #a4ffff with #001565.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#528ab2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020303 is the darkest color, while #f5f8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#528ab2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#78848c is the less saturated color, while #0597ff is the most saturated one.
